What is Neuro-Linguistic Programming (NLP)?
Neuro-linguistic Programming (NLP) is the study of how people
represent experiences internally and externally, real or
imagined, as well as the corresponding effect of how the nervous
system functions. NLP is a technique that focuses on how you
perceive the world through your 5 senses. This produces an
effective change - by learning how to communicate and listen to
yourself and finding which behaviors and or thoughts must be
modified.
